Community Service Learning

Each grade level in Middle School has a distinct Service Learning experience which enables students to learn about important causes and participate in meaningful service work.

Grade 6

Service Learning

Grade 6 students spent time discovering the concept of service learning. They studied the four different types of service including direct, indirect, advocacy, and research.

Grade 7

Our Environment

During the third quarter of the school year, all Grade 7 students worked on a service project of their choice during Oasis time. Their focus was on SDGs 13-15: Climate Action, Life Below Water, and Life on Land. Projects ranged from cleaning the local beach, to raising awareness of our climate crises, and supporting our community stray cats and dogs. The focus of these projects was to learn about communities in need as well as the process of the project cycle. Student groups are responsible for raising awareness, collections, events, and delivering the final donations.

GRade 8

Service Initiatives

Grade 8 students chose one of two service projects: Basmat Amal or the Water Project. Both dive deep into the Sustainable Development Goal (SDG) 4 Quality Education. Students focusing on Basmat Amal divided into groups to create awareness of the importance of education and organized collection campaigns to support families affected by the Syrian conflict.

Students focusing on the Water Project learned about SDGs 6 & 10 Clean Water and Sanitation and Reduced Inequalities.

Green team

The middle school Green Team meets after school on a weekly basis to work on different initiatives focused on environmental protection in collaboration with the high school Green Team.
